How To Make Fresh Semolina and Egg Pasta Recipe

Ingredients
- 2 cups semolina flour
- 2 large eggs
- 1 tbsp salt
- Water (if needed)
Instructions
-
In a large mixing bowl, combine the semolina flour and salt. Make a well in the center.
-
Crack the eggs into the well and slowly start incorporating the flour into the eggs.
-
Knead the mixture into a smooth and elastic dough. If the dough is too dry, add a little water.
-
Cover the dough with a clean cloth and let it rest for 30 minutes.
-
Divide the dough into smaller portions and roll each portion into a thin sheet using a pasta machine or rolling pin.
-
Cut the rolled dough into desired pasta shapes such as fettuccine, spaghetti, or ravioli.
-
Cook the fresh pasta in a large pot of boiling salted water for about 3-5 minutes or until al dente.
-
Drain the cooked pasta and toss with your favorite sauce or toppings.
